Understanding the Science Behind Time Travel
Theoretical frameworks like Einstein's theory of relativity suggest that time is a flexible dimension affected by speed and gravity. For example, traveling at speeds close to light can theoretically allow for time dilation, where time moves differently for travelers compared to those at rest.
